1. Feeling the Chaos? Start with Your Space
Our surroundings have a huge impact on our mental state. When life feels overwhelming, start by tidying up a small corner of your home—it can make a world of difference.
- Quick Declutter: Choose a small area—like your nightstand or a shelf—and remove anything that doesn’t belong. A clear space leads to a clear mind.
- Surface Wipe Down: Use a cleaner with a fresh, uplifting scent like lemon or lavender. This simple act can refresh both your space and your mood.
- Add Greenery: A small plant like a succulent or a potted herb can bring life and serenity to any corner.
- Personal Touches: Display a favorite photo or a meaningful trinket to remind you of happy memories.
- Comforting Textures: Place a soft cushion or a cozy throw to create a welcoming, zen-like space.
2. Breathe in Calm: Essential Oils to Soothe the Mind
Aromatherapy is a powerful tool for relaxation, and using essential oils is one of the easiest ways to create a calming environment. Different scents can influence your mood, so let’s dive into how to make the most of them.
- Citrus Boost: Diffuse bergamot or mandarin oil in the morning to uplift your spirits and start the day with a positive mindset.
- Lavender Relaxation: In the evening, try lavender or chamomile oil to help you unwind and prepare for a restful night’s sleep.
- Eucalyptus Clarity: For moments of mental fog, diffuse eucalyptus or peppermint oil to clear your mind and refresh your senses.
- DIY Calm Spray: Mix a few drops of your favorite essential oil with water in a spray bottle and mist your space for an instant mood lift.
- Pulse Point Application: Apply a drop of calming essential oil like sandalwood or frankincense to your wrists or behind your ears for on-the-go stress relief.

4. Savor the Calm: Herbal Teas for a Peaceful Mind
When stress starts to creep in, there’s nothing like a warm cup of herbal tea to soothe your nerves. Herbal teas are a natural way to calm the mind and restore balance.
- Chamomile: Known for its calming properties, it’s perfect for winding down before bed.
- Peppermint: Refreshes and invigorates without the jolt of caffeine, ideal for an afternoon pick-me-up.
- Lemon Balm: Helps soothe an overactive mind, making it easier to relax after a long day.
- Passionflower: Reduces anxiety and promotes a sense of calm, great for moments of high stress.
- Rooibos: Naturally caffeine-free and rich in antioxidants, it’s a soothing option for any time of day.
5. Light Up Your Space: Cozy Lighting Tips
Lighting sets the mood in your home, and creating a cozy ambiance can make your space feel like a true sanctuary. Here’s how to get it just right:
- Candles: Use scented candles with soft, flickering light to create a warm, calming atmosphere. Opt for natural wax candles to avoid harmful chemicals.
- Small Lamps: Place a small, soft-lit lamp in your favorite corner to create a cozy reading or relaxation spot.
- LED Strip Lights: Install these behind furniture or under shelves for a subtle, ambient glow that’s easy on the eyes.
- Wireless Lights: Keep handy wireless lights with adjustable color temperature for flexibility as you move around your home.
- Adjustable Brightness: Choose lights with dimming features to set the perfect mood for any time of day or night.
